Description: 

MFA in Visual Arts with English as the language of instruction is a multi-directional study programme conducted by all faculties of the Academy, based on the student's individual educational path, tailored to his/her predispositions and interests. The studies last two years (4 semesters) and prepare to obtain the Master's degree.

From the academic year 2022/23 the E. Geppert Academy of Art and Design in Wroclaw offers additionally one place of master studies with a new double diploma path in partnership with Tokyo University of the Arts, Japan. The double degree program is aimed at candidates specializing in printmaking. Students qualified for the program will complete two semesters in Poland and two in Tokyo Geidai. By fulfilling the requirements of both institutions, the student will be able to receive two diplomas:

  • The Eugeniusz Geppert Academy of Art and Design in Wrocław – MFA in Visual Arts,
  • Tokyo University of the Arts, MFA in printmaking.
